General Purpose:
The Business Intake Specialist provides crucial operational and analytical support to billing attorneys and the Business Intake team in the Office of General Counsel by executing sophisticated intake processes and departmental operations. Under general oversight, this role provides the firm's billing attorneys with a reliable, efficient, and seamless new business intake experience by effectively procuring, researching, analyzing, and capturing the required key information received from the billing attorney while expertly navigating the requirements of the intake process to ensure clients are onboarded and matters are opened and maintained accurately and efficiently while complying with firm best practices, policies, and procedures. This role receives comprehensive training in legal intake/operations and compliance, with structured development opportunities that build expertise in entity research, conflict identification, and legal operations management. As a critical component of the firm's risk management infrastructure, the Business Intake Specialist ensures accurate data capture and procedure compliance that directly impacts matter opening efficiency, client satisfaction, revenue protection, compliance with the Rules of Professional Conduct and applicable federal law related to "know your client" obligations, and mitigation of malpractice exposure and disqualification risks.
Essential Duties/Responsibilities:
- Responsible for assisting the Business Intake Manager, Ethics & Conflicts Managers, Managing EBI Counsel and Director of Ethics, Ethics & Conflicts Counsel, and Business Intake and Training and Lateral Intake Supervisors with departmental operations including financial coordination, professional correspondence, meeting logistics, communication management, training event coordination, and other reasonable administrative department-related responsibilities to ensure seamless department functionality and support strategic initiatives.
- Responds to inquiries from firm personnel seeking copies of existing engagement letters by retrieving and distributing the requested documents or, if the letters cannot be located, providing alternative relevant engagement information and communication details.
- Maintains the billing attorneys Business Intake Specialist document management folders and files approved engagement letters in the appropriate locations.
- Under general oversight with developing independence, accurately captures and analyzes key data received from billing attorneys to open new matters or add parties to existing matters from start to finish in an accurate and efficient manner providing the billing attorney with an exceptional intake experience and ensuring the firm complies with matter set up obligations. This entails:
- effectively communicates the intake requirements of the firm to billing attorneys, utilizing consultative approach to obtain necessary information and ensure complete data capture,
- conducts sophisticated entity research and analysis utilizing the internet, and advanced research platforms (Lexis Diligence, Capital IQ, and various government websites) to determine the complete names of entities, correct relationships and affiliations of each party, and determining the corporate structure of entities involved to ensure accurate recording of information and to uncover relevant information helpful for conflict report generation and conflict clearances,
- drafting engagement letters to ensure the proper clauses are incorporated based on each unique matter and that the firm's standard terms of engagement are in place with the client,
- complying with firm policies and procedures, and
- navigating the electronic business intake system.
- Under general oversight, collaborates with billing attorneys by generating reports that identify active intake requests that have become dormant and resolves them to completion.
- Under general oversight, updates and cleans up active intake requests in the electronic business intake system when billing attorneys leave the firm. May need to follow up with relevant parties to obtain additional information required to complete these updates.
- Develops expertise in departmental communications management, progressing toward independent handling of routine inquiries and correspondence.
- Builds proficiency in late shift operations, including email management and intake initiation to support the firm's comprehensive service delivery.
- Under general oversight, develops proficiency in lateral attorney hire client onboarding processes, supporting seamless integration of new attorneys and their client relationships, as needed.
- Under general oversight, develops skills in signed engagement letter review and approval process, including monitoring workflow systems and ensuring compliance with firm standards, as needed.
